Garden Features & Events

Maquette Gallery - visit by written appointment only. Exhibition of Tony Cragg's sculptures in a new beautifully landscaped area incorporating an old chalk pit.

Description of Garden

At Goodwood a visitor will find a 24 acre site enclosed on two sides by an historic listed flint wall. It contains a changing collection of contemporary British sculpture in a very beautiful setting on the South Downs overlooking Chichester. There are now over 70 large-scale works and over the past 10 years, the owners have commissioned more than 100 large-scale sculptures from over 120 British artists. Every year around a third of the works move on to new homes around the world, making room for new commissions.

History Of Garden

Victor Shanley, the designer worked with forester Peter Harland and grounds manager Martin Russell to design the garden. They have devised an on-going plan of woodland renewal with native species of broad-leaf trees, adding to the diversity of stock and providing background colours that change with the seasons.
